One Month
It's been one month since we left Toronto airport and although it has gone by quickly, we feel like we have already done so much! The north island has been incredible but with the holidays approaching we are getting excited about heading to the south island on January 1st. Chad is really busy at the clinic and my work with the temp agency is picking up. I am surprised at how much I miss being a physio and look forward to finding my next job in the field. The work with the temp agency has allowed us to see many different venues in Wellington and meet quite a few other travellers. We spent this past weekend completing a hike with another backpacker from England. The hike was beautiful along the south coast of the north island. We have never experienced winds so strong, Chad spent most of the hike laughing at me as I almost blew over! We have really enjoyed being in Wellington, it is such a beautiful city, but only just over three more weeks until th head out travelling again!
